Bournemouth-based department store, Beales, has signed up to be part of the ‘Safe Places’ scheme, set up by Bournemouth YMCA and Bournemouth Borough Council.
The YMCA ‘Safe Places’ scheme is for young people with disabilities which enables them to find support if needed when they are out in Bournemouth town centre. This can include getting confused, injured or lost.
Mark Stevens, Beales Bournemouth store director, said: “We have placed stickers in the windows of the store making it clear that we are part of the ‘Safe Places’ scheme so that vulnerable young people can come in and will be looked after. All our store staff have been briefed so they know what to do if someone needs assistance.”
